A state-owned waterfront park along the Weymouth Back River, its 23 acres converted from a former sand and gravel pit into a stroller-friendly gravel loop trail with restrooms and picnic areas.

Can I bring my dog to Stodder's Neck?
Allowed caged, bridled, or on a leash or tether no longer than ten feet, unless an area is posted otherwise; never unattended or at large, and waste must be carried out. Hunting, hunting-dog training, dog sledding, sled-dog training and search-dog training are excepted (302 CMR 12.13).

What rules should I know at Stodder's Neck?
Fishing here is subject to state consumption advisories for mercury and PFAS contamination. Dogs are allowed off-leash only in designated areas of the park. Hunting is prohibited.
